### Account Recovery — Catalogue Import (Lintwood)

Quick one for review: when the Lintwood catalogue import wipes a patron's session table, the recovery flow re-seeds accounts from the nightly snapshot. Check that the importer skips locked accounts — last time it didn't. To rerun recovery against staging you'll need the vault passphrase, which is appended just below.

recovery phrase for yafof-tajof: julmir-kelax-julvan-holath-belvan-holir-ralael-ralvan-ralath-julvan-silmir-istmir-kaswyn-ulamir

## Authentication

The Furrowlink gateway authenticates every telemetry push from field units before forwarding readings to the Harvestband ingest cluster. New team members should note that tokens are scoped per-device and rotate quarterly; never reuse a bench-test token on production combines. For local development against the staging ingest endpoint, the gateway reads one credential from its environment at startup. Place the internal Harvestband service key directly below this line.

app token of kajop-tahag = qvz23-qaEp6MzrfP2AwhVbZwsZeUq

Subject: DR Drill — QueueForge Migration

Hi — during Thursday's disaster-recovery drill we'll simulate losing the old homegrown job queue and failing over to QueueForge. Please verify the replay worker restores pending jobs within fifteen minutes. To unlock the QueueForge standby cluster during the drill, you'll need the recovery passphrase provided just below.

unlock words, fahop-yageg: ralwyn-kelath

Ticket for the weekly sync: the quota vault backing Fennelgate's per-tenant rate limits locked after three failed unseal attempts during last night's config rollout. Tenants currently fall back to default limits, so no customer impact yet, but overrides cannot be edited until the vault is reopened. The rollout script has been paused and the bad credential removed. To unseal the vault, use the recovery passphrase below.

unlock words, yawig-kagef: gordor-holvan-ulaael-pramir-ulaiel-tamdor